    Day 1

    Arusha-Tarangire National Park

    1 stop
  • 1

    Tarangire National Park is most popular for its large elephant herds. This is why it is also called the elephants paradise with up to 300 elephants living in the park. The place is well-known for a mini-wildlife migration that takes place during the dry season (June-October). During this time, 250,000 animals enter the park to the Tarangire River, the main source of fresh water in Tarangire-Manyara ecosystem (Masai steppe). You will get a chance to see all different kind of birds since the park has almost 500 species of birds.

  • Day 3

    Full day Game drive in Serengeti National Park

    1 stop
  • 3
    Serengeti National Park

    After an early coffee you will start a full day game drive into the Park that will take you into the different circuits. The park ecosystem supports the greatest remaining concentration of plains game in Africa. This legendary Park is the most renowned safari destination for its incredible population of lions and leopards. The central portion of the Serengeti - known as Seronera area is one of the richest wildlife habitats in the park. It features the Seronera River, which provides a valuable water source to the vegetation in the area, attracting many wildlife species well representative of the Serengeti. In Seronera, one must really look out for the many lion prides that thrive in this region. In addition, of great interest are the Serengeti “Kopjes” which are massive boulders of granite located in the sea of grass. They provide ample shelter to a large variety of flora and fauna. The eventful day comes to an end with a delicious dinner and a good night’s rest in your accommodation.

  • Day 4

    Serengeti-Ngorongoro Crater

    1 stop
  • 4
    Ngorongoro Conservation Area

    After breakfast, you will have a morning game drive in Serengeti National Park. Later, you will depart for Ngorongoro Conservation Area with a short picnic-lunch. The destination is the Ngorongoro Crater, the largest collapsed volcanic crater in the world with a length of fourteen kilometers of isolated natural beauty. Ngorongoro Crater is surrounded by a ring of extinct volcanoes. On the floor of the volcano, dotted with watering holes, 30,000 animals find shelter. The day will end with the drive back to Arusha town, marking the end of your beautiful trip. At this point, we are sure you will have had a fantastic experience and made long-lasting memories.
